St. Lucia - Experience the Island Life

St. Lucia, known for its rich and diverse culture and beautiful landscapes is a tear-drop shaped island, located in the Caribbean sea. The varied topography of the landmass and the majestic coastline makes it the ultimate destination for a much-needed vacation. Sunbathing at the Sugar Beach


The Sugar Beach is a landmass of white sand, spectacularly located between the two Pitons. The view from the land and the sea is quite phenomenal and something you should not miss during your stay. Bask in the warm sunny weather on the public loungers at the beach, or rent one in the private beaches which are luxurious and more comfortable.

Hike the Pitons


The Pitons are the twin volcanic plugs shaped like shark teeth, rising sharply from the sea. The Gros Piton is roughly 150ft taller than the Petit Piton; however, it is comparatively easier to trek. You can rent safety gears from St. Lucia hotels and head on for a six-hour climb involving narrow switch backs and volcanic stone steps. Enjoy the breath-taking views of the waves crashing on the foot of the hill and the beaches from the top.


Kitesurfing at Anse des Sables


The waters off the Anse des Sables are sprinkled with colorful sails as kite surfers zoom over the waves. The strong winds and smooth waters, unhindered by dangerous obstacles make for a spectacular destination for surfing enthusiasts across the globe. You can rent a kiteboard from the local surfers and also learn the techniques needed to enjoy this water sport.


Dig into the Caribbean Style Cuisine


Once you are on the island, the most popular dishes that you must try are the traditionally Caribbean fish stews and guava cheesecakes. The island’s most unconventional cuisine includes lionfish ceviche and, pumpkin soup. If you are looking for a more elevated fare, try a serving of Creole cuisine in the form of fresh fish in tomato salsa, available at St. Lucia resorts.

Visit the Sulphur Springs


The dormant Soufriere Volcano, which is commonly known as the Sulphur Springs can be accessed by road. You can drive up to the edge of the steam and mud-filled crater and experience the natural phenomena of these mud baths. The locals of the island are of the opinion that the mud baths are beneficial for the skin, so take a dip for an uncommon sensation.
